Android Downloading Do Not Turn off Target
If you are an Android user, you may have experienced or you are encountering this issue – downloading… do not turn off target. This is an error message that often happens on Samsung and some Nexus devices. Most users reported the device unexpectedly rebooted into a screen with the error.
The issue happens mainly because you press the wrong button combinations to access the recovery mode of your phone. On Samsung and Nexus devices, the key combination to enter this mode is Power + Home + Volume Up. But if you press Volume Down instead of Volume Up, the phone will enter the download mode instead of recovery mode and you see the error message.
Besides, downloading do not turn off target S7/S6/, etc. can be triggered by a software glitch.

Solutions to Download Do Not Turn off Target Android
Exit Download Mode
If you press the wrong buttons to enter the download mode and get the error, you can exit this mode to easily fix the issue. This is the quickest way.
Step 1: Make sure your phone is on the screen “Downloading… Do not turn off target”. And press Power + Home + Volume Down at the same time.
Step 2: Keep pressing these buttons until the screen is black and release them.
Step 3: If the phone cannot reboot automatically, press the Power button manually. Then, check if your issue is resolved. If not, move to the next solution.
Force Rebooting Your Phone
It is easy to operate and you can follow these steps below:
Step 1: Press the Power button to turn off the device. If this cannot help, remove the battery after taking out the back case.
Step 2: If you have a SIM card and SD card, take out them.
Step 3: Press and hold the Power button for at least 20 seconds after removing the battery to discharge any left power from the internal components and the capacitors.
Step 4: Put back your card and battery and turn the device on again to see if it can boot up properly without the downloading error.
Wipe Cache Partition
If the above methods cannot fix Android downloading do not turn off target, perhaps your phone has a firmware glitch. Perhaps deleting the cache partition may be a good choice.
1. Turn off the phone completely by pressing the Power If this doesn’t work, remove the battery and hold Volume Down + Power until the screen shuts down.
2. Press and hold Volume Up + Home + Power at the same time. Release them until you see the Android system recovery screen.
3. Highlight wipe cache partition and select it.
4. After the process is completed, select Reboot system now.
Perform a Master Reset
If all of the ways cannot fix downloading do not turn off target, the last way you can try is performing a master reset. This can delete everything on your phone including videos, app data, photos, contacts, music, etc. that are not stored on the SD card.
Before the master reset, you had better make a backup for these files in the safe mode:
- Power off your phone, press and hold the Power button to turn it on.
- After the initial screen appears, release the Power button and hold the Volume Down button.
- When seeing Safe Mode, release this button.
- Go to Settings > Advanced Settings > Backup & reset > Back up my data.
Then, start the master reset:
